Course Directors: Scott A. Helgeson, M.D. and Bryan J. Taylor, Ph.D.

This course explores various aspects of cardiopulmonary physiologic testing, including cardiopulmonary exercise tests, pulmonary function tests, submaximal stress tests, and impulse oscillometry. Emphasis is placed on the interpretation of these studies, incorporating diverse patient scenarios to enhance clinical understanding and application.

Target Audience

Target audience includes physicians, physician assistants, and nurse practitioners in the specialties of pulmonology, cardiology, internal medicine, and family medicine.
Respiratory therapists and exercise physiologists may also benefit from this course.
